Topographic Surveys in Pinole: Local Conditions

Pinole's geography splits neatly in two, and each half asks something different of a topographic survey. The hillside subdivisions that ring the valley put homes on cut-and-fill pads with slopes above, below, or both — and any addition, deck, pool, or retaining wall on those lots needs contours that reflect the real ground, not an interpolation between sparse shots. Our Trimble terrestrial laser scanner captures millions of survey-grade points across a hillside lot in a single visit, including slopes too steep or brushy to walk safely with a rod. In the office we filter the vegetation from the point cloud and deliver a bare-earth digital terrain model, 1-foot contours, spot elevations, and a layered DWG/DXF base map ready for your architect or geotechnical engineer.

Down in the old town core, the challenges change. Pinole's original blocks date to the 1800s rancho era, lots are compact, and structures often sit close together near Pinole Creek. Scanning excels here too: we capture buildings, curbs, walls, and grades without needing repeated access to tight side yards, and creek-adjacent parcels get honest top-of-bank and channel mapping to support drainage and setback review. Along the shoreline margins and the flatter ground near the I-80 retail corridor, portions of the low-lying land fall within state-mapped liquefaction zones under the Seismic Hazards Mapping Act, and geotechnical reports on those sites are built on top of accurate site topography like ours.

Every Pinole topographic survey includes research at the Contra Costa County Recorder and County Surveyor in Martinez, where we pull recorded subdivision maps, records of survey, and benchmark data so the mapping is tied to a defensible datum. If aging or missing property corners are also in question — common on old town blocks — we can fold boundary resolution into the same project.

Our Process

1

Scope & Research

We confirm the mapping limits, contour interval, and datum your project requires, and review record maps and benchmarks for the site.

2

Field Scanning

We capture the site with a Trimble terrestrial laser scanner plus GNSS/total-station control, recording millions of survey-grade points in a single visit — terrain, structures, walls, trees, and utility surface features.

3

Point Cloud Processing

Scans are registered onto project control, vegetation and noise are filtered, and a ground surface is extracted to build the digital terrain model.

4

Base Map Delivery

You receive a layered DWG/DXF topographic base map — contours, spot grades, features, and boundary if requested — with the point cloud available on request.
